Instituto Franklin - UAH just published through its collection “Biblioteca Benjamin Franklin”, a critical edition of the "Historia de la Nveva Mexico" by Gaspar de Villagrá, with Manuel M. Martín-Rodríguez in charge of this new edition. He is Professor of Literature at the University of California, Merced. Professor Martín-Rodríguez is a specialist in Hispanic literature of the United States, from colonial times to current issue, which is a subject he explores in his previous four books, as well as numerous essays.
This edition reproduces the original text of 1610, without changes of any
kind. This edition includes an introduction to the poem’s major artistic and structural resources, which emphasize its literary value. It includes the text of the work and an appendix with copies of the census preserved from the original. Also, his 849 notes clarify many doubts, correct errors of interpretation from previous years, and identify enigmatic references.
